JD>>>> 3) How does the "private message" work? CA>>> There are no private messages within FIDO echos. I've CA>>> often wondered why OLRs even make the attempt to mark CA>>> messages as 'private'. ml>> because QWK-type OLRs came to us from the RIME/PCRelay ml>> network which did/does have private messages in ml>> conferences... fido stuffs have been bastardized and ml>> forcefitted into that format instead of having software ml>> conformant to fido's needs and specs...
